网友您好, 请在下方输入框内输入要搜索的题目:

题目内容 (请给出正确答案)

若有定义“int k,*q;”,则下列各选项中,赋值表达式正确的是( )。

A.q=(&k+1)

B.q=&k

C.q=k

D.*q=&k


参考答案

更多 “ 若有定义“int k,*q;”,则下列各选项中,赋值表达式正确的是( )。A.q=(k+1)B.q=kC.q=kD.*q=k ” 相关考题
考题 现有如下定义:int a,b,*p,*q;,则下列赋值语句错误的是A.p=a;B.q=b;C.p=q;D.p=a;

考题 现有如下定义:int a,b,*p,*q;,则下列赋值语句错误的是A.p=a;B.q=b;C.p=q;D.p=a;

考题 若有定义:int k,*q;,则下列各选项中赋值表达式正确的是()。A.q=(k+1)B.q=kC.q=kD.*q=k+1)B.q=kC.q=kD.*q=k

考题 若有定义:int k,*q;,则下列各选项中赋值表达式正确的是A.q=(k+1)B.q=kC.q=kD.*q=k

考题 若变量已正确定义为int型,要通过语句:scanf(”%d,%d,%d”,a,b,给a赋值l、给b赋值2、给 若变量已正确定义为int型,要通过语句:scanf(”%d,%d,%d”,&a,&b,&C.;给a赋值l、给b赋值2、给C赋值3,以下输入形式中错误的是( )。(注:口代表一个空格符)

考题 设有下列定义:struct sk{ int m; float x; }data,*q;若要使q指向data中的m域,正确的赋值语句是( )。A.q=data.m;B.q=data.m;C.q=(struct sk*)data.m;D.q=(struct sk*)data.m;

考题 3、下列哪一种表达式是错误的?A.q=λΔt/δB.q=hΔtC.q=kΔtD.q=rtΔt

考题 【单选题】若有定义:double *q,p;则能给输入项读入数据的正确程序段是()A.q=p;scanf("%lf",*q);B.q=p;scanf("%lf",q);C.*q=p;scanf("%lf",q);D.*q=p;scanf("%lf",*q);

考题 若有以下定义,则赋值正确的是()。 int a, b, *p; float c, *q;A.q=c;B.q=a;C.p=c;D.p=a;E.a=b;